Challenge 23, ‘Butterfly Circus’ was stimulated by a short film of the same name. Director /Writer Joshua Weigel brings us a disabled man’s story of hope against all odds. “Butterfly Circus” was The Winner of The Doorpost Film Project 2009. To see this short film, please visit The Doorpost.com
This theme concept for the Butterfly Circus was brought to us
by artists Rusty Harden and Ray Wilkins.
